# Tollgate Consent Banner — Environments

The Tollgate consent banner rolls out across three environments: sandbox, preview, and production. Sandbox disables consent persistence entirely; preview stores choices in Varnholt-region storage only; production enforces regional residency. Reviewers should confirm that logging excludes pre-consent identifiers. Each environment's enforced configuration appears below.

config for hawep-taweg:
[frair]
port = 8443
region = west-3
host = frair.sivrelhq.internal
team = oliael
timeout_ms = 1000
retries = 2

Meeting notes — Thursday logistics sync, Verrow Biologics. Agreed that the chilled sample batch for Calmont Labs goes out Tuesday morning, not Monday, so the gel packs can be swapped fresh at 06:00. Driver should take the Harwick Road route to avoid the bridge works and log the cooler temperature at departure and arrival. Marta will confirm the dock bay with Calmont's intake team the evening before. The hand-over instruction below must be followed exactly and not shared outside this run:

handover note for yagef-bagep: the drudor pelius courier leaves the kasdor zorvan norir ledger at gate 8016 under passcode 755406

## Step 4: Update Gating Rules

Canary gating in Ferrowise 3.x replaces the old percentage ramp with windowed error-budget checks. Plugins that previously read the ramp schedule must now query the gate evaluator. Legacy gate definitions are ignored silently, so migrate before upgrading. Promotion only occurs when all registered gates pass for the full observation window. Your plugin should validate against the current gate configuration, shown below.

settings of tagef-bawif:
DRUIX_HOST=druix.zemvarlabs.internal
DRUIX_PORT=8000

Subject: FD-hunt baton pass

Hey all — quick heads-up before the weekly sync. The leaked-file-descriptor hunt in Quillgate's ingest workers is moving off my plate since I'm rotating onto the Larkspur release. We've narrowed it to the retry pool in the socket shim, so it's close. Going forward, all FD-hunt questions and escalations should go to the person named below.

named custodian: Brivan Eliath Quenox Frador